Hawks Captain Isaac Ahola had no hesitation to bat upon winning the toss at the Vasse Playing Fields on Saturday morning.
Runs came at a steady rate through a number of good batting partnerships, that led to four players batting through to retirement being Isaac Ahola (14no), Ethan Ahola (13no), Harvey McGovern (8no) and Dylan Bateman (6no).
The team's running between wickets vastly improved and helped them to 114 for a loss of four wickets after the allotted 26 overs.
Spectators were treated to some very good catching by Hawks Green - including two catches by keeper Bateman and fielder Zac Carlson.
This and a caught and bowled wicket by Isaac held Vasse to 48 for the loss of 6 wickets at the half way mark of their innings.
However the remaining Vasse batters limited Hawks Green to just one additional wicket for the rest of their innings - being a good catch taken by Jimi Traianos.
Vasse were restricted to 96 for the loss of seven wickets. Wickets were shared between Ethan, Rocco Giles, Isaac, McGovern, and Reuben Bain.
